Writing the Perfect Cover Letter for a Recruitment Agency Opening
Securing your dream role in recruitment requires more than just a polished resume. A specific cover letter is essential to showcase your passion for the industry and demonstrate how your skills and experience align with the specific requirements of the opportunity. When applying for a recruitment charge role, it's crucial to write a compelling narrative that grabs the attention of hiring managers and convinces them to consider your application further.
Start by investigating the company's culture, values, and current projects. This knowledge will allow you to tailor your letter and demonstrate a genuine enthusiasm in their work.
- Emphasize your proven track record of success in talent acquisition.
- Demonstrate your ability to foster strong relationships with both candidates and clients.
- Measure your achievements whenever possible, using concrete examples.
Finally, edit your letter carefully to ensure it is free of any grammatical errors or typos. A well-written and polished cover letter can make a significant impact in your job application process.

A Persuasive Cover Letter for a Human Resources Management Role
Securing a position in human resources management requires a strong and persuasive cover letter. Your letter should emphasize your relevant skills and experience while demonstrating your passion for the field. Start by addressing the targeted requirements outlined in the posting.
Illustrate your familiarity of key HR responsibilities, such as talent acquisition, payroll management, and training. Provide tangible examples from your previous assignments to support your assertions.
Adjust your letter to the company's culture. Explore their website and social media presence to acquire their brand. This will allow you to articulate how your skills and qualifications align with their goals.
Conclude your cover letter by reemphasizing your enthusiasm in the position and expressing your confidence in your ability to add value. Proofread thoroughly for any inaccuracies.
